DENN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

136 of the 4,409 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Denny's (DENN)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$770M — up 4.2% from $739M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 26 funds opened new DENN positions and 14 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 39 added to existing stakes and 50 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Cardinal Capital Management LLC (Connecticut), adding an estimated $12.9M. The largest seller was Avenir Corporation, cutting an estimated $12.3M.
